Third-party integrations enhance project management software by connecting it with various tools and platforms. This streamlines workflows, improves productivity, simplifies time tracking, and centralizes communication and data management. How we picked the 5 top rated products

We chose the high-performing solutions on this list based on verified user ratings on our site. Depending on available data, qualifying products either had to be among the most user-reviewed or the most searched-for products in the Project Management software category. They also needed to have sufficient reviews about third-party integrations, have a minimum user rating of 3 out of 5 for that feature, and show evidence of U.S. market presence. We then added a distinction for up to three products based on our proprietary ratings and reviews: Highest rated, Highly rated for third-party integrations, and Highly rated for free version. Sponsorship or client status has no influence on the selection of these products, but it may impact the order in which products appear.

Key features for Project Management software

Based on GetApp's analysis of verified user reviews collected between July 2021 and August 2024.

  • Task Management: Reviewers highlight the ability to create, assign, and track tasks with customizable due dates and priorities. Notifications and real-time updates enhance team coordination and efficiency. 94% of reviewers rated this feature as important or highly important.
  • Project Planning/Scheduling: Users value the ability to create detailed project timelines, set milestones, and manage task dependencies. Gantt charts and real-time collaboration facilitate effective project tracking and resource allocation. 93% of reviewers rated this feature as important or highly important.
  • Multiple Projects: Reviewers appreciate the capability to manage multiple projects simultaneously, providing clear organization and oversight. Features like separate boards, labels, and customizable templates enhance project tracking and prioritization. 93% of reviewers rated this feature as important or highly important.
  • Workflow Management: Reviewers note the benefit of automating repetitive tasks, customizing workflows, and visualizing progress through tools like Kanban boards. This leads to streamlined processes and increased efficiency. 90% of reviewers rated this feature as important or highly important.
  • Collaboration Tools: Users highlight the importance of real-time editing, commenting, and shared workspaces for improving team communication and coordination. Integration with other tools and platforms is also valued. 89% of reviewers rated this feature as important or highly important.
  • Access Controls/Permissions: Reviewers emphasize the ability to customize user roles and permissions, ensuring secure and controlled access to sensitive information. This feature helps maintain data privacy and organizational structure. 88% of reviewers rated this feature as important or highly important.
